In OM2008.12, the dbus signal for the headset changed. I have a script
that should work if you want it.  Let me know and I can throw it up
when I get into work tomorrow. However, I think a better program was
linked not too many days ago.

Personally, I use frameworkd for all that now.

> I also confirm that on my box the headset detection is not working
> and that your thread http://marc.info/?l=openmoko-community&m=122067281800506&w=2 is a good starting point for a fix.
> On my box, the command
> dbus-monitor --system type='signal',path='/org/freedesktop/Hal/devices/platform_neo1973_button_0_logicaldev_input'
> does not output anything when I plug / unplug the headset.
>
> For now I'm manually switching between alsa 'scenarios'
> using your helpful http://atariland.net/~dreilly/openmoko/headphones.state file.
